MANF gene

Known as: Mesencephalic Astrocyte-Derived Neurotrophic Factor Gene, ARGININE-RICH PROTEIN, MESENCEPHALIC ASTROCYTE-DERIVED NEUROTROPHIC FACTOR 
This gene is involved in the regulation of both function and survival of dopaminergic neurons.
